-
552 votes7 answers1451 views
什么是堆栈跟踪,如何使用它来调试应用程序错误?
有时,当我运行我的应用程序时,它给我一个错误,看起来像: Exception in thread "main" java.lang.NullPointerException at com.example.myproje... -
1 votes0 answers598 views
如何匹配新的StackTrace以抛出Exception.StackTrace
我试图获得一个堆栈跟踪而不抛出异常,它工作(人类可读),我唯一的问题是两种方法之间的格式是不同的 . 这是Unity的一个问题,因为它解析了从throw到open VS到关联行#的格式 . 因此,如果我使用新的StackTrace,格... -
308 votes24 answers249 views
显示正在运行的Python应用程序的堆栈跟踪
我有这个Python应用程序不时被卡住,我无法找到在哪里 . 有没有办法告诉Python解释器向您显示正在运行的确切代码? 某种即时堆栈跟踪? Related questions: Print current call stack f... -
1275 votes28 answers757 views
如何将堆栈跟踪转换为字符串?
将 Throwable.getStackTrace() 的结果转换为描述堆栈跟踪的字符串的最简单方法是什么? -
424 votes9 answers939 views
如何在Node.js中打印堆栈跟踪?
有谁知道如何在Node.js中打印堆栈跟踪? -
691 votes30 answers734 views
如何从Android应用程序获取崩溃数据?
如何从我的Android应用程序获取崩溃数据(至少是堆栈跟踪)?至少在使用有线电视检索我自己的设备时,最好是从我在野外运行的应用程序的任何实例,以便我可以改进它并使其更加坚固 . -
0 votes1 answers141 views
分段错误 - 奇怪的调试语句
我正在尝试使用函数跟踪构建我自己的异常类(我想知道调用异常的所有函数的文件和行号,以及它们总共调用函数的次数) 函数跟踪似乎在构建它时起作用,但是当试图正确使用它时,我被分段错误所困扰 . 我跟踪了其中的一些(愚蠢的错误,比如忘记返回... -
552 votes7 answers1685 views
什么是堆栈跟踪,如何使用它来调试应用程序错误?
有时,当我运行我的应用程序时,它给我一个错误,看起来像: Exception in thread "main" java.lang.NullPointerException at com.example.myproje... -
304 votes8 answers1892 views
获取导致异常的异常描述和堆栈跟踪,全部作为字符串
我在Python中看到了很多关于堆栈跟踪和异常的帖子 . 但还没找到我需要的东西 . 我有一大堆Python 2.7代码可能引发异常 . 我想 grab 它并分配给 string 它的完整描述和导致错误的堆栈跟踪(我们只是在控制台上看... -
134 votes12 answers658 views
“软件导致连接中止的正式原因:套接字写入错误”
Given this stack trace snippet 引起:java.net.SocketException:软件导致连接中止:java.net.SocketOutputStream.socketWrite0(本机方法)中的套...